Maybe you can learn something from these stories: A certain family came to the Ajah neighborhood over 12years ago when land in Thomas Estate (along the road) was less than N80,000 only. Their business was booming, they had three cars in the family, they could afford to buy several plots but they didn’t. The agents were begging them to buy but this place was so lonely at that time. They used to drive from VI to their house in the Oluwatedo neighborhood in less than ten minutes, at times without passing a car on the road. Today the same land in Thomas Estate is worth over N25million per plot. When they eventually bought a plot in 2011 in the oluwatedo area; they paid over N10million with “abeg” sir. Just imagine how much they would have today if they had bought six plots for N480, 000 only by disposing one of their three cars. Six plots in Thomas Estate today (along the road) is over N150 million.-Imagine the difference! Last year, we witnessed the sales of two plots of land bought by a lady in 2001 in the Majek neighbourhood, after Oluwatedo for N50,000 i.e N25,000 per plot. These two plots were sold for over N8million in the remote Bashorun Estate. We‘ve got copies of the old receipts. There are two real Estate investment stories that never stop to amaze me. A certain man had an opportunity to buy land in the Ajah neighborhood in 1999. An agent-his friend took him to the place. He told his friend the Agent that he was not interested but if he wants; he can lend him money to buy. He loaned his friend the Agent N300,000 with which he bought one Acre of land i.e. six plots. Today, those six plots are worth over N60, 000,000 and the man never stops regretting that miss. In 1999, this man considered Ajah bush and refused to invest. That time, Chevron and VGC were a stone throw and these two facilities were enough pointers to the future of the neighborhood yet he refused to invest. Now there is this other man that invested in Lekki Phase 1 in 1979 when it was a very thick forest. This man is well known today in the Jakande neighborhood of Ajah, he wanted to buy two plots at N5,000 only but could not afford them because he had earlier bought Peugeot 504 for about N5000 also, this place was no man’s land. By the help of his father he bought two plots. Today, these two plots are worth over N500, 000,000. He lives in one which he could not afford to build on until the 90’s and he rents the house on the second plot out for almost N5, 000,000 per annum.
